Making Money by Flipping Homes

Monday, October 18th, 2010

The term flipping in real estate translates to buying and reselling houses after carrying out all structural and cosmetic repairs. Oddly enough everyone wants to buy a house that needs major repair work.

There are essentially three ways to successfully flip homes; one by buying-repairing-selling, two by buying-selling as is to other investors or home flippers and three by buying-repairing-letting out on rental or lease basis-selling.

The first one is beneficial if you want quick money with marginal home repair expenses. The next one works well for those who haven’t the time to work or the resources to hire out handy men and want quick returns.
The last however seems the best option, because you have plenty of time after your initial investment to receive best returns. Also the house remains in pristine condition if you find a good tenant until you are ready to resell when property prices hike.

Use certified home inspectors while buying real estate

Thursday, October 14th, 2010

The certified home inspector is required to inspect the home. Each side of the home must be reviewed and a written statement must be recorded. The inspector checks the roof, overhangs, soffit, or face-board, gutters and chimney. Each window is inspected to determine what type of window is being used and for any faults.

The home inspector is required to review and record the condition of the interior of the home as well. Each interior room must be looked at, and any presence of defects must be recorded. The condition of the kitchen, bathrooms, closets, bedrooms, living areas and basement is also recorded by the home inspector.
The last thing the home inspector is required to check is the mechanics of this home. This inspection includes the electrical wiring, electrical panel and breakers and electrical outlets, to determine whether the outlets provide enough voltage as well as correct voltage; and the water heater; furnace and air-conditioning unit to make sure that they are all working properly.

Find your dream house through home inspections

Thursday, October 14th, 2010

The home is one of the biggest investments that you will ever make in your life. For this you have to make sure that the home, which you intend to buy, is in good condition. Though there is a home appraisal required for all Federal Housing Administration (FHA) mortgages, many borrowers get confused and mistakenly assume that a FHA appraisal is a guarantee for the house being in good condition or not. If you wish ever to avoid buying a lemon for your money, then you will need a home inspection. The home inspectors can help you by evaluating the structure and construction of the home; by estimating the remaining useful structure of the home and mechanical systems. Also they are able to judge the potential problems and items which will need to be repaired or replaced.

Due to this, a home inspection will be in your best interests. It is really a good idea to get home inspection done before purchasing a home.
